Confirmed that a private sale occurred this past week for a Divinity #3 (LaRosa 1:20) CGC 9.8 for $460. Not mine, but a fairly active seller that I deal with frequently.
As you may know, another copy sold on 27 Oct on eBay for right at $400. Last week a raw copy sold for $200.
